Notable changes: - Build regression fixes for various platform updates (https://github.com/libuv/libuv/pull/3428, https://github.com/libuv/libuv/pull/3419, https://github.com/libuv/libuv/pull/3423, https://github.com/libuv/libuv/pull/3413, https://github.com/libuv/libuv/pull/3431) - Support for GNU/Hurd (https://github.com/libuv/libuv/pull/3450) - Release tool improvements (https://github.com/libuv/libuv-release-tool/pull/13) - Better performing rw locks on Win32 (https://github.com/libuv/libuv/pull/3383) - Support for posix_spawn API (https://github.com/libuv/libuv/pull/3257) - Fix regression on OpenBSD (https://github.com/libuv/libuv/pull/3506) - Add uv_available_parallelism() (https://github.com/libuv/libuv/pull/3499) - Don't use thread-unsafe strtok() (https://github.com/libuv/libuv/pull/3524) - Fix hang after NOTE_EXIT (https://github.com/libuv/libuv/pull/3521) - Better align order-of-events behavior between platforms (https://github.com/libuv/libuv/pull/3598) - Fix fs event not fired if the watched file is moved/removed/recreated (https://github.com/libuv/libuv/pull/3540) - Fix pipe resource leak if closed during connect (and other bugs) (https://github.com/libuv/libuv/pull/3611) - Don't error when killing a zombie process (https://github.com/libuv/libuv/pull/3625) - Avoid posix_spawnp() cwd bug (https://github.com/libuv/libuv/pull/3597) - Skip EVFILT_PROC events when invalidating events for an fd (https://github.com/libuv/libuv/pull/3629) Fixes: https://github.com/nodejs/node/issues/42290 PR-URL: https://github.com/nodejs/node/pull/42340 Reviewed-By: Michaël Zasso <targos@protonmail.com> Reviewed-By: Juan José Arboleda <soyjuanarbol@gmail.com> Reviewed-By: Yagiz Nizipli <yagiz@nizipli.com> Reviewed-By: Darshan Sen <raisinten@gmail.com> Reviewed-By: Antoine du Hamel <duhamelantoine1995@gmail.com>
